How Technology Transforms Travel Planning
Technology has revolutionized travel planning, making it more accessible, efficient, and personalized than ever before. With the advent of mobile applications and online platforms, travelers can easily compare prices, access customer reviews, and book flights or accommodations in real time, eliminating the need for traditional travel agents. Advanced algorithms analyze user preferences to offer tailored recommendations, while virtual reality allows potential travelers to explore destinations before making decisions. Social media platforms play a pivotal role in inspiring wanderlust through stunning visuals and travel stories. Furthermore, integration of AI-powered chatbots provides instant support, ensuring that any questions or issues arise during the travel planning process can be addressed promptly, enhancing the overall experience. Ultimately, technology not only simplifies logistics but also empowers travelers to curate their own unique journeys.

Innovative Gadgets and Apps for Travelers
In today's fast-paced world, innovative gadgets and apps have transformed the travel experience, making it more seamless and enjoyable for explorers. Smart luggage equipped with GPS tracking and built-in charging ports allows travelers to keep their belongings secure and devices powered. Portable Wi-Fi hotspots ensure connectivity in remote areas, while translation apps, such as Google Translate, break down language barriers in real-time, enhancing communication with locals. Additionally, navigation apps like Google Maps or Citymapper offer detailed directions, even offline. Meanwhile, travel planning apps like TripIt organize itineraries and reservations in one place, assisting travelers in maximizing their adventures with ease and efficiency.

The Future of Travel: Trends to Watch
The future of travel is poised for transformative change as several key trends emerge, driven by advancements in technology and a shift in consumer priorities. Sustainability is becoming paramount, with travelers increasingly seeking eco-friendly options like carbon-neutral flights and green accommodations. The rise of remote work has led to the popularity of "workation" packages, allowing individuals to blend work and leisure in picturesque locales. Additionally, technology such as AI-powered travel assistants and virtual reality experiences are enhancing trip planning and immersion. Health and safety remain in focus, with contactless services and flexible booking policies expected to define the post-pandemic travel landscape. As personalization becomes the norm, data-driven insights will enable a seamless and tailored travel experience.
